Overview

Triple OG is an indica-dominant hybrid cannabis strain with an 80% indica and 20% sativa ratio, created through a three-way cross of Triangle Kush, Constantine, and Master Yoda strains. Originally bred by Exotic Genetix, this strain has gained significant recognition for its potent effects and exceptional quality. The genetic lineage combines the robust, earthy characteristics of Triangle Kush with the unique properties of Constantine and Master Yoda, resulting in a strain celebrated for its gassy profile, quality bud structure, and phenomenal yields. Triple OG exhibits a complex terpene profile dominated by beta-caryophyllene, myrcene, and limonene, contributing to its distinctive aromatic palette of earthy, citrusy, and spicy notes. The strain produces oversized, dense minty green buds with dark olive leaves, thin orange hairs, and a generous coating of dark purple-tinted crystal trichomes, indicating its rich cannabinoid and terpene content.

Growing Information

Triple OG is considered moderately challenging to grow, suitable for intermediate to experienced cultivators. The strain has a flowering time of 8-9 weeks (56-70 days) and grows to medium to tall heights both indoors and outdoors. Indoor yields can reach up to 13 ounces per square meter (3 ounces per square foot), while outdoor cultivation can produce up to 16 ounces per plant or approximately 500 grams per plant. The strain thrives in warm, humid climates and is fairly resistant to mold and pests. Growing methods such as Sea of Green (SOG) or Screen of Green (SCROG) are recommended due to its wide branching structure. Regular pruning and trimming are essential for optimal airflow and light penetration. Triple OG produces heavy, dense buds with exceptional quality and requires proper support for its thick branches.
